dictionary-en.com Free online language dictionary.

de­lay in french

Word:
de­lay (Number of letters: 6)
Dictionary:
english-french
Translations (9):
ajourner, différer, éloigner, reculer, renvoyer, retarder, temporiser, arriérer, attarder
Related words:
french de­lay, de la warr, de la soul tour, de la soul, de la salle school, de la salle jersey, de­lay in french, ajourner in english
de­lay in french